Licencpartner, often translated as licensing partner, is a party involved in a licensing arrangement in which the owner of intellectual property (the licensor) grants another party (the licensee) the right to use that IP within defined terms. The licensing partner is typically the licensee who commercially exploits the IP, though in some contexts the term may also refer to a collaborator or distributor working with the IP owner.
